If you are looking for a gorgeous cabin in the woods, then Saddlehorn Cabin is the one for you! Surrounded by lush greenery and breathtaking views of the Teton mountain range, you can enjoy fishing, hiking, skiing, and beautiful views right outside your door! Saddlehorn is located one hour from Grand Teton National Park and about two hours from Yellowstone. Whether you are looking for adventure or just to relax in beautiful surroundings, Saddlehorn is perfect for your next getaway!
Saddlehorn has a traditional cabin feel and is tastefully furnished and decorated. The spacious windows provide amazing views of mountains and greenery. Enjoy free wi-fi, cable television, comfortable beds, a washer and dryer, and a kitchen with everything you will need to whip up a tasty meal. The cabin is peaceful and secluded.
Sleeping Arrangements Bedroom 1 - Queen Bed (Sleeps 2) Bedroom 2 – Two Twin Beds (Sleeps 2) Additional Sleeping: Air Mattress available upon request (Sleeps 1)
Property Highlights Amazing views Clean and comfortable Wi-Fi Cable TV Warm, cozy, relaxing Cross-country trails Great location Close to Grand Targhee
Location Nearest Supermarket - less than 10-minute drive to Broulim's Supermarket Distance to Airport - Approx. 1hr 15-minute drive to Jackson Hole Airport
Nearby Attractions: Targhee Village Golf Course - less than a 10-minute drive Teton Creek - less than a 10-minute drive Teton River -less than a 10-minute drive (Great for trout fishing) Grand Targhee Resort - less than a 25-minute drive Grand Teton National Park - approx. 1-hour drive Snake River - approx. a 1-hour drive (Great for trout fishing) Jackson Hole - little more than a 1-hour drive Yellowstone Nat'l Park - less than a 2-hour drive
Great places for: Mountain Biking - Aspen Trail, Horseshoe Canyon, Spooky Trail, Rick’s Basin or Grand Targhee Hiking - Teton Canyon to Alaska Basin, Table Mountain, Darby Canyon, or Moose Creek Golfing - Headwaters Club at Teton Springs, Huntsman Springs, Targhee Village, or Teton Reserve

About the area
Located in Driggs, this cabin is in a rural area and on a river. Alta Community Park and Caribou-Targhee National Forest reflect the area's natural beauty and area attractions include Linn Canyon Ranch and Teton Valley Foundation's Kotler Arena.
